I have a new house to clean they are picky about their tile. They want high shine no streaks. How should I clean them?
@DebbieNobodyneedstoknow1
@DebbieNobodyneedstoknow1 2 жыл бұрын
Ivory on a cloth full strength, then hot, hot water to rinse it. Then dry it with a flannel receiving blanket cloth or really good quality bedding sheet fabric. Drying well is what will really bring the shine and ensure no streaks. I’ll try to do get a video up for next weekend about the kind of cloths I use for various jobs. I have a how to clean a shower like a pro video that might help. Ivory washes our glassware to a shine. It does the same thing to tile and is effective at washing away germs and bacteria.
